Laravel maintenance can be divided into several important categories based on application needs and business goals.
Corrective maintenance focuses on identifying and fixing existing problems within a Laravel application. These issues may include broken functionality, unexpected errors, performance bottlenecks, or compatibility problems.
Even carefully tested applications may develop issues after deployment due to changing environments, increased user activity, new integrations, or unexpected scenarios.
Corrective maintenance involves analyzing error reports, debugging application code, identifying root causes, and implementing reliable solutions.
A professional Laravel support team does not simply fix visible problems. They investigate the underlying reason behind an issue to prevent it from happening again.
For example, if users experience slow checkout processing in an eCommerce application, corrective maintenance involves examining database queries, payment gateway interactions, server resources, and application logic to find the actual cause.
This approach creates long-term stability rather than temporary fixes.

Technology changes constantly. New operating systems, browsers, devices, APIs, and security requirements emerge regularly. Adaptive maintenance ensures that Laravel applications continue working correctly in changing environments.
For example, when a third-party payment service updates its API, a Laravel application using that payment integration may require modifications. Similarly, changes in hosting environments or database versions may require application adjustments.
Adaptive maintenance keeps applications compatible with the latest technology standards.
It also helps businesses adopt new opportunities without rebuilding their entire application.

Laravel includes built-in protections against many common threats, including cross-site scripting, SQL injection, and cross-site request forgery. However, these protections must be properly configured and maintained.
A strong Laravel support strategy ensures security features continue working effectively as applications evolve.

Laravel regularly introduces improvements, security updates, performance enhancements, and new features. Keeping an application updated helps businesses benefit from these improvements.
However, Laravel upgrades require careful planning because changes between versions may affect application functionality.
Professional Laravel maintenance services handle framework upgrades safely by reviewing compatibility, testing features, updating dependencies, and resolving migration issues.
A proper upgrade process usually involves:
Analyzing the current application structure
Reviewing Laravel upgrade requirements
Updating dependencies
Testing application features
Fixing compatibility issues
Deploying changes carefully
Regular upgrades prevent applications from becoming outdated and difficult to maintain.

Modern applications rarely work independently. Most Laravel applications communicate with external services through APIs. These integrations may include payment gateways, shipping systems, social platforms, analytics tools, cloud services, and third-party software.
API maintenance is an essential part of Laravel application support because external systems frequently change.
An API that works today may require adjustments tomorrow due to updated authentication methods, new data structures, or service changes.
Laravel API maintenance includes reviewing API performance, updating integrations, improving security, and ensuring smooth communication between systems.
Proper API management helps maintain:
Reliable data exchange
Secure communication
Faster responses
Better integration stability
Improved user experience
Poorly maintained APIs can create unexpected failures. A payment API issue, for instance, could prevent customers from completing purchases. Regular monitoring and testing reduce these risks.

Data is one of the most valuable assets for any business. Losing application data can create serious operational and financial challenges.
Laravel backup and disaster recovery services protect businesses from unexpected situations such as server failures, technical errors, accidental data deletion, or security incidents.
A reliable backup strategy ensures that important information can be restored quickly.
Backup management involves:
Regular data backups
Backup verification
Secure storage
Recovery planning
Testing restoration processes
Many businesses create backups but fail to test whether those backups can actually be restored. Professional maintenance services ensure backup systems remain functional when needed.
Disaster recovery planning reduces downtime and helps businesses return to normal operations quickly.
